从n个元素的数组中选择5个元素,并对这5个元素应用冒号排序

时间:2017-06-10 19:21:09

标签: algorithm time-complexity

如果我有一个n个元素的数组,我先取5个元素并对它们应用冒号排序,然后取出第3个最大元素。那么这将是什么时间的复杂性。

我认为这将是不变的。 原因为什么我这么认为

O(1)选择5个元素。 O(5 * 5)I.e等于O(1)用于冒泡排序,O(1)等于第3最大元素。

1 个答案:

答案 0 :(得分:0)

任何不依赖于输入大小的算法都是常量。所以在你的情况下,它不依赖于数组大小,所以是的,它是恒定的。